The European Parliament has now approved legislation to phase in a levy on high-carbon imports based on the CO2 emitted in producing them. As Statista's Martin Armstrong notes, the law is a world-first and awaits final approval from EU countries - expected within a few weeks. The tax aims to put pressure on countries outside of EU borders to put a price on CO2 emissions - while also countering the benefits to EU industries relocating to regions with weaker environmental laws.
